Berkeley County has experienced tremendous growth as part of the booming Charleston metro area. According to the U.S. Census Bureau, Berkeley County is among South Carolina's fastest-growing counties, driven by economic development, military presence, and quality of life.
The county seat of Moncks Corner serves as the government and commercial center, while Goose Creek, Hanahan, and portions of Summerville offer suburban living. The county spans over 1,100 square miles, providing diverse land opportunities from developed areas to rural wilderness.
Joint Base Charleston's Naval Weapons Station is a major employer, spanning over 17,000 acres and contributing significantly to the local economy.
Berkeley County is home to Lake Moultrie, one of South Carolina's largest lakes at 60,400 acres, offering prime waterfront land opportunities.
Volvo Cars operates its only U.S. manufacturing facility in Berkeley County, bringing thousands of jobs and economic investment to the region.
Part of the 260,000-acre Francis Marion National Forest lies within Berkeley County, providing vast natural resources and recreational land.
Berkeley County contains numerous historic rice plantations along the Cooper River, reflecting its rich colonial and agricultural heritage.
